WHAT UPTURNED EYES MEAN FOR YOUR LASHES

When your outer corner is naturally higher, you already have that "cat-eye" lift. The best lash style for you will enhance that lift, not compete with it. You want the longest strands concentrated on the outer third of your eye. That simple change makes your eyes look wider, awake, and balanced—without the need for a drop of liner.

What you want to avoid: lashes with equal length across the whole band. They fight against the natural shape, make your eyes look round and small, and generally age you. Also avoid super thick bands, which drag the eye down and hide your natural lift.

THE 3 BEST LASH STYLES FOR UPTURNED EYES

1. Cat-Eye Lashes
Cat-eye lashes have their longest strands concentrated on the outer corner. For upturned eyes, this is the single best choice because it mirrors your natural shape. The result is a soft, wing-like extension that makes your eyes look bigger and brighter. It's a classic for a reason—it's the most forgiving style for upturned shapes and looks equally good on hooded and almond eyes.

2. Wispy Scallop Lashes
These alternate short and long spikes, creating a fluttery, feathered effect. The irregular lengths soften the eye area and add an "effortless" feel. Wispy lashes are perfect when you want to look done-up but not overdone—the strands catch the light and make your eye shape feel airy, not heavy.

3. Natural Almond Lashes
An almond shape keeps the longest strands at the center, which adds a touch of rounded softness to upturned eyes. This is a great choice for days when you want your eye shape to be the star. Almond lashes add width instead of height, making your eyes feel more balanced and open.

A QUICK NOTE ON WHAT TO AVOID

Skip any lash style that has the same length from inner corner to outer corner. Also skip ultra-dense, thick bands. They feel heavy and sit badly on upturned shapes. The worst offender? Cheap lashes with a stiff, flat band that refuses to follow the curve of your eye. If the band doesn't flex, the lash will pop loose at the inner corner within an hour.

WHAT TO LOOK FOR IN A LASH STYLE

Use this when you're shopping, and you won't waste another dollar on the wrong pair:

  • Outer-corner length: The longest strands should be on the outer third—this is your upturned-eye secret weapon.
  • Featherweight band: A light, flexible band disappears on your lash line. A heavy one pulls your eye down.
  • Natural taper: Strands that taper at the tip look like real lashes. Blunt-cut strands look fake.
  • Curve memory: The band should spring back into its shape after you bend it. If it stays bent, the lash will lose its lift halfway through your night.

Find a lash that hits all four, and your upturned eyes will finally get the attention they deserve.

LASH STYLE FAQS

Can I wear dramatic lashes with upturned eyes?

Yes—but choose a dramatic style that puts the length on the outer third, not evenly across the whole lash band. This keeps the lift where it matters.

Should I curl my lashes if I have upturned eyes?

Probably not. Your lashes already have natural lift. Curling them can push them into an awkward, almost 90-degree angle that doesn't look natural.

What lash lash shape is best for everyday wear?

A natural almond or light wispy scallop is perfect for daily wear because it adds softness without drawing too much attention to the eye area.
